What Is Green Web Hosting?

Green web hosting refers to providers that reduce or offset the environmental impact of running web servers. This can include:

  • Using renewable energy (like wind or solar)
  • Purchasing carbon offsets
  • Running energy-efficient data centers

 

1. GreenGeeks – Most Popular Green Host

Why it stands out:

  • 300% energy offset (for every unit of energy used, they put 3 back into the grid)
  • Fast SSD storage & built-in caching
  • Free CDN and SSL
